Ingredients
For the Papad Cones
- 4 pcs Masala Papad
For the Filling
- 1 cup Rice Puffs (muri)
- 1 cup Tomatoes finely chopped
- 1 cup Cucumber finely chopped
- 1/2 cup Onion finely chopped, optional
- 1 cup Namkeen haldiram's or any preferred brand
- 2 tbsp Tomato Ketchup for garnish, optional
- 2 tbsp Coriander Chutney for garnish, green, optional
- 1/2 tsp Salt or to taste
- 1/4 tsp Chili Powder or to taste, red
- 1/4 tsp Chaat Masala for added flavor, optional
Instructions
Prepare the Papad Cones
- Break each papad into two equal semicircles. Microwave one papad at a time for 20-25 seconds, or until soft and pliable.
- While the papad is still hot and pliable, carefully curl it into a cone shape. Secure the edges to maintain the cone shape. Repeat with the remaining papad pieces.
Prepare the Filling
- In a medium bowl, combine the rice puffs, chopped tomatoes, chopped cucumber, chopped onion (if using), namkeen, salt, red chili powder, and chaat masala. Mix well.
Assemble the Cones
- Fill each papad cone generously with the prepared mixture.
- Place each filled cone in a small glass or shot glass to help it stand upright. Add a small amount of the mixture to the base of the glass for stability.
Garnish and Serve
- Garnish each cone with tomato ketchup and green coriander chutney (if using).
- Serve immediately. The cones will become soggy if left to sit for too long.
Recipe Notes
Expert Tips for Perfect Masala Papad Cones
- For extra crispy cones, you can lightly toast the papads in a dry pan before microwaving.
- Feel free to customize the filling with your favorite vegetables and spices. Try adding finely chopped carrots, bell peppers, or cilantro.
- If you don't have a microwave, you can soften the papads by briefly heating them over a gas flame, being careful not to burn them.
- For a spicier kick, increase the amount of red chili powder or add a pinch of green chilies to the filling.
